Afternoon everyone I am looking for a jet boat for parker and lower river. Budget is around 25,000. 19ft to 23ft is what size I want. Something I can hammer down on when I am by myself but also a great cruiser when the wife and my 1 year old daughter is on. Show me what you got. Thanks to all who respond.
I was in your position many years ago. Went through 3 bass boats before getting into performance boating. Right before my son was born I bought a 1995 new 22' Magic open bow closed cockpit, was great for a baby. When he got a little older I switched to jets, I have several nephews all close in age. I also bought into a front row river place at Echo with my sisters family, her father in law bought the mobile new and sold it to them. I bought a 1987 21' closed bow Eliminator, same as the brown one in this thread. Great boat, but I decided to add power. Don't do that with young kid's, keep it stock and in good repair so you don't get stranded with kid's. Did that once, stuck across the river from Bluewater. 7 hours later after getting towed then a ride back to Echo for truck & trailer I went home and found a 2004 21' open bow Cobra, 3 years old 47 hours,, really loved this boat. Wanted to go fast again so I bought 2nd boat for this. When it breaks I had ol reliable. Fast forward kid's going to college, sell everything to make sure he comes out debt free, 1 more year to go. I kept the fast boat, you never get any money back on those. Also picked up a family cruiser at the end of last season too.

My advice to you would be a not to old 21' to 22' open bow, Cobra, Ultra Stealth, Eliminator... That brown Eliminator on here would be a maybe for me, you have to think reliable when running around the river. Have a good anchor so if you do break you don't drift to far. Side note I always went up river in my performance boat so when it broke I could put a life jacket on, rope & noodle to the bow eye and swim it home, several times.

Used boat pricing is still a bit stupid right now. Take your time and go look at some boats, be thorough with questions. If anything doesn't look or feel right to you walk away. I saw lot of good pictures that turned out to be turds.
